Native Americans were not considered U.S. citizens until the Indian Citizenship Act of 1924. Prior to this, many Native Americans were excluded from citizenship despite being born in the United States, as they were often seen as members of sovereign tribal nations. The act aimed to recognize their rights as citizens, although many states found ways to keep Native Americans from voting for years afterward.
